About the role

Mater Private Hospital Brisbane are seeking enthusiastic Registered Nurses with experience in Scrub/Scoutsfor permanent positions, full time or part time roles on offer and immediate start available. 

This is an exceptional opportunity to join our Perioperative department which boasts up to 15 operating theatres (including Neuroscience & Paediatrics theatres) across our private hospital settings, our main centre of excellence specialties include. 

  • Paediatrics
  • Orthopaedics 
  • Robotics 

Salary range: $40.27 - $51.74 (Registered Nurse Level 1) per hour plus superannuation & Salary Packaging 

What you’ll be doing

Whilst displaying the highest level of clinical standards for the unit you will be responsible for:

  • Achieving optimal patient outcomes throughout the patient journey and continuum of care
  • Demonstrating exceptional clinical expertise and knowledge of procedures and the management of patients seeking outstanding care
  • Implementing strategies to ensure that quality and risk management are integrated into service provision.
  • Working collaboratively with the nursing team to provide exceptional care every time.
  • Maintaining current knowledge and skills to ensure continued professional growth.

About you

You will be driven by a challenging yet rewarding environment where you can bring your energy and experience to this dynamic and exciting unit.

Other skills and experience include:

  • Minimum 3 years’ experience as a Registered Nurse in a Perioperative -Scrub/Scout setting
  • Current AHPRA nursing registration as a Registered Nurse (no restrictions)
  • Ability to work in an ever-changing and fast paced environment.
  • A strong work ethic, positive attitude and willingness to role model and promote the Mater values.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and the ability to liaise with all levels of the multidisciplinary team.
  • Demonstrated ability to operate both in a team environment and autonomously using initiative, sound reasoning and strong listening, negotiation and decision-making skills.
  • Strong attention to detail and organisational skills
  • Commitment to ensuring the levels of service is always delivered to patients at all times.
